The core concept is simple yet captivating. Players watch an airplane take off, and as it ascends, a multiplier increases. The longer the plane flies, the higher the potential payout. However, the airplane can fly away at any moment, causing the multiplier to reset to zero. The challenge lies in knowing when to cash out before the plane disappears, securing a profit while minimizing risk. The Role of the Random Number Generator
The RNG is paramount to the integrity of the game. It generates a random number that determines the point at which the airplane will fly away. This number is generated before the round begins and is not influenced by any external factors, including the platform operator or other players. The use of cryptographic hashing ensures that the RNG's output is unpredictable and unbiased. Players can often verify the fairness of a round by checking the cryptographic proof provided by the platform, further solidifying trust in the game's integrity. The Importance of Bankroll Management
Effective bankroll management is arguably the most crucial aspect of playing the aviator game. It involves setting a budget for your gaming sessions and sticking to it, regardless of wins or losses. A good rule of thumb is to only bet a small percentage of your bankroll on each round, typically between 1% and 5%. This helps to minimize the risk of depleting your funds quickly and allows you to weather losing streaks. It’s also important to set win limits and stop playing when you reach them, ensuring that you lock in your profits. Ignoring bankroll management can lead to impulsive betting and significant financial losses.
Furthermore, practicing emotional control is vital. Avoid chasing losses or making reckless bets based on frustration or excitement. Treat the game as a form of entertainment, not a source of income, and never gamble with money you can’t afford to lose. The Role of Near Misses
One particularly potent psychological effect is the phenomenon of “near misses”. When a player cashes out just before the airplane flies away, they experience a sense of disappointment but also a feeling that they were close to winning big. This near-miss experience can be more motivating than a small win, as it reinforces the belief that a large payout is within reach. The brain interprets near misses as positive reinforcement, encouraging players to continue playing and try again. This is a cleverly-designed element that contributes significantly to the game’s addictive qualities and encourages prolonged engagement.
The sense of control – even if it’s illusory – is also a key factor. Players feel involved in the outcome through their timing of the cashout, reinforcing the feeling that skill, rather than pure chance, is at play.
